    The following is an excerpt from the 10g online documentation. Note the items that I have put in bold.
    "FILE_DATASTORE
    The FILE_DATASTORE type is used for text stored in files accessed through the local file system.
    Note:
    FILE_DATASTORE may not work with certain types of remote mounted file systems.
    FILE_DATASTORE has the following attribute(s):
    Table 2-4 FILE_DATASTORE Attributes
    Attribute Attribute Value
    path path1:path2:pathn
    path
    Specify the full directory path name of the files stored externally in a file system. When you specify the full directory path as such, you need only include file names in your text column.
    You can specify multiple paths for path, with each path separated by a colon (:) on UNIX and semicolon(;) on Windows. File names are stored in the text column in the text table.
    If you do not specify a path for external files with this attribute, Oracle Text requires that the path be included in the file names stored in the text column.
    PATH Attribute Limitations
    The PATH attribute has the following limitations:
    If you specify a PATH attribute, you can only use a simple filename in the indexed column. You cannot combine the PATH attribute with a path as part of the filename. If the files exist in multiple folders or directories, you must leave the PATH attribute unset, and include the full file name, with PATH, in the indexed column.
    On Windows systems, the files must be located on a local drive. They cannot be on a remote drive, whether the remote drive is mapped to a local drive letter."

    Launch the Console application by entering the first few letters of its name into a Spotlight search. Enter the name of the crashed process in the “Filter” text field. Post the messages from the time of the last crash, if any -- the text, please, not a screenshot.
    Then, still in the Console window, look under User Diagnostic Reports for crash logs related to the process. Select the most recent one and post the contents -- again, not a screenshot. For privacy’s sake, I suggest you edit out the “Anonymous UUID,” a long string of letters, numbers, and dashes in the header of the report, if it’s present (it may not be.)

    First, be sure you have updates to AA6.0.6, the lastest version of AA6. I have no idea about any AA6.1. How did you create the PDF? To get the links to work properly you need to use PDF Maker. Printing to PDF will allow links, but they are only those that Acrobat or Reader recognize as such and are not actually built in links. If you start getting into non-standard URLs that include spaces and punctuation, then Acrobat will not properly recognize the links.
